Hatchet Project 
Create a project of your choice that demonstrates your comprehension, reflection and connections to the novel "The Hatchet" by Gary Paulsen.

Connections

Poor

The project aspects have little connection to the story and even show some misunderstanding about events.
Fair
Good
Excellent

The project aspects have great connection to the story and even show much understanding about events.
Accuracy

Poor

The project shows items and/or events that might not have occurred in the story or are exaggerated.
Fair
Good
Excellent

The project shows many items and/or events that have occurred in the story and shows them in very accurate detail.
Organization

Poor

The project shows little planning and forethought and some parts appear to be incomplete or rushed.
Fair
Good
Excellent

The project shows superior planning and forethought and many parts are well presented and unique.
Effort

Poor

The student has not adequately used their time and needed excessive reminders to attend to their task.
Fair
Good
Excellent

The student made great use of their time and was an exemplary model of staying focused to their task.
Conventions

Poor

The student has made little effort to conventions. This has not met many language arts grade level expectations.
Fair
Good
Excellent

The student has been very attentive to conventions. This has exceeded many language arts grade level expectations.
